npTDMS is a cross-platform Python package for reading and writing TDMS files as produced by LabVIEW, and is built on top of the numpy package. Data read from a TDMS file is stored in numpy arrays, and numpy arrays are also used when writing TDMS file.

Typical usage when reading a TDMS file might look like:

from nptdms import TdmsFile

tdms_file = TdmsFile("path_to_file.tdms")
channel = tdms_file.object('Group', 'Channel1')
data = channel.data
time = channel.time_track()
# do stuff with data

And to write a file:

from nptdms import TdmsWriter, ChannelObject
import numpy

with TdmsWriter("path_to_file.tdms") as tdms_writer:
    data_array = numpy.linspace(0, 1, 10)
    channel = ChannelObject('Group', 'Channel1', data_array)
    tdms_writer.write_segment([channel])

Installation

npTDMS is available from the Python Package Index, so the easiest way to install it is by running:

pip install npTDMS

Alternatively, after downloading the source code you can extract it and change into the new directory, then run:

python setup.py install

What Currently Doesn’t Work

This module doesn’t support TDMS files with XML headers or with extended floating point data.
